Accessing GP services in North East Lincolnshire on Early May Bank Holiday

GP practice services in North East Lincolnshire will be operating on Friday (Early May Bank Holiday/VE Day). This support will be in line with the way general practice services are currently being delivered in response to the COVID-19 pandemic.

The current coronavirus restrictions mean you should not attend a GP surgery unless you have been told to do so.

If patients need medical help for anything other than symptoms of coronavirus (a high temperature or a new, continuous cough) on the Bank Holiday they should ring their own practice for advice. The telephone advice may be provided by their own practice or they may have made arrangements with another practice to provide this support. If, following telephone triage, it is deemed they need to be seen, individual practices will either be seeing patients at their own premises or they will have made arrangements with another practice to see them.

If patients have coronavirus symptoms they should call 111 or use the online service 111.nhs.uk/covid-19/.

Patients will also be able to access pharmacies. Please click this link for opening times. This is correct at the time of publishing however we would advise you to check before making a special journey.

After normal hours patients should ring 01472 256256 for urgent medical enquiries (not coronavirus) and 111 if they have coronavirus symptoms.
